Quick answer
Disney does not sell an all-you-can-drink beverage package. Disney Cruise Line does not sell an all-inclusive drink package. Alcohol is bought a la carte at bars and lounges, and Disney runs paid beverage tasting seminars. Soft drinks are complimentary with meals and at self-serve stations, while specialty coffees and teas are sold individually.

No all-inclusive package
See the quick answer above for how Disney handles individual drink purchases. An 18% gratuity is added automatically to bar and beverage tabs.
